Output e0fcb6d1956c9ea8d6dfb97b6992c78c086ed4c760e56fd9d7796136296f0c2f:3

value
258866166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ccea6f81b09c0f9a8a1fc53465367cf41f66685 OP_EQUALVERIFY OP_CHECKSIG
address
13dKUpXcrRfgDQva9EWFbwyXa6qVdGFPrJ
transaction
e0fcb6d1956c9ea8d6dfb97b6992c78c086ed4c760e56fd9d7796136296f0c2f
confirmations
573331
spent
true